my white count tends to be just above the high range when I am tested.
But my doctor has told me that a viral infection, tends to lower white count.(this is most common) Here is a good wiki on this: https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Leukopenia Notice that there are many drugs that can cause it too. Sometimes it is a simple thing... B12 and folate and copper levels when low can reduce blood cell production.
